Aragen Life Sciences files DRHP for IPO, aiming for ₹800 crore fresh issue and an Offer For Sale. Funds to be used for debt repayment and capex.

Aragen Life Sciences has filed its Draft Red Herring Prospectus (DRHP) with Sebi for an Initial Public Offering (IPO) featuring a ₹800 crore fresh issue.

IPO Structure Details

  • Fresh Issue: ₹800 crore
  • Offer For Sale (OFS): Up to 27,329,192 equity shares

Proceeds from the fresh issue are slated for repaying or pre-paying existing borrowings. Funds will also cover capital expenditure, including new equipment for Hyderabad facilities and at its Aragen Biologics Private Limited Bengaluru facility.

Aragen’s Market Position

  • Established: 2000
  • Operates as: Integrated Contract Research, Development and Manufacturing Organisation (CRDMO)
  • Largest Indian CRDMO by solutions breadth: as of March 31, 2026
  • Rank: Among top three Indian CRDMOs by operating revenue
  • Global CRDMO market estimate: $171 billion in fiscal 2026

The company serves 591 global customers, which include 16 of the top 20 Big Pharma companies. It focuses on new chemical entities (NCEs) and new biological entities (NBEs) across markets like the US, Europe, Japan, and India.

Operational Milestones

  • CRO business launched: 2002
  • Second-largest Indian CRO solutions platform by scientific personnel: as of March 31, 2026
  • Biologics segment expansion: 2014 via acquisition
  • One of only two Indian CRDMOs offering integrated small-molecule drug substance and drug product development services

As of March 31, 2026, Aragen employed 4,362 individuals, with 3,412 scientific personnel. Of these, 479 hold PhD degrees, resulting in a 14.04% PhD-to-scientific personnel ratio, the highest in the Indian CRDMO industry.

Financial Performance Highlights

  • Revenue growth (fiscal 2025-2026): Second-highest among Indian peers
  • Revenue from operations CAGR (fiscal 2025-2026): 14.64%
  • Profit for the year CAGR (fiscal 2025-2026): 26.86%
